Easter: Ajia preaches love, sacrifice among Nigerians

Date: 2018-04-03

The Founder of Mohammed Ajia Ibrahim (MAI) Foundation, Alhaji Mohammed Ibrahim Ajia, has urged the citizens to embrace peace, love and unity in the face of adversaries confronting them.

Ajia specifically admonished them to cultivate selfless sacrifices and employ all available lawful channels to resolve their differences amicably rather than yielding to divisive tendencies capable of igniting conflict.

In his Easter Message issued in Ilorin, Ajia identified inflammatory comments as some of the factors festering disunity among Nigerians, saying that the nation is safe and secure through spirit of collectivity

He said patriotic citizens should not give way to questionable elements who are bent on bringing the country to a standstill by their actions and inactions.

Ajia, a retired senior police officer, expressed optimism that Nigeria has potentials to be pacesetter in the global arena owing to her distinct peculiarities, of which some other countries are not privilege to possess.

"In this season of love and sacrifice, it is incumbent on us Nigerians to tolerate one another, live in peace and not in pieces. Our aspirations are quick and better achieved when all of us work as a team and embrace spirit of collectivity.

"We must not yield to divisive tendencies, which could impede our attainment of greater goals. This country is blessed with human and material resources and because of these potentials alone, we can rule the world.

"There is no need for a soothsayer to reveal to us that there are questionable elements who are bent on igniting conflict and bringing this country to a standstill through inflammatory comments, actions or inactions. Our strength lies in our collective spirit put together.

"For Christian brethren, we need to remember that this period of Easter is a reflection of love, sacrifice, passion and unity of purpose in attaining our set goals. We must therefore see the need to always be our brothers keepers and avoid tendencies that could threaten our existence", the Founder of MAI FOUNDATION said.

Ajia also called on Kwarans not to loose hope in spite of the daunting challenges, assuring that there will be a new Kwara if we keep hope alive.
